4,3,2,1 (Method Man, Redman, Canibus, DMX, Master P, LL Cool J)
“I’m the illest nigga alive, watch me prove it, snatch ya crown with your head still attached to it”
-Canibus
This is definitely one of the dopest posse cuts. I’m not even gonna put “Who Shot Ya” on here, I’d rather go with this one. I wanted to put Canibus’ whole verse down as the quote, he ripped it. You gotta excuse the quality of the video, I wanted to have the version with Canibus and Master P. Canibus original verse is ill, I wouldn’t take it as a diss to LL though, I don’t know why surgery boy got offended. I’m glad he did though, cuz “G.O.A.T” was an ill cd, if it wasn’t for Canibus, I wouldn’t own any LL cds. Did they really have to throw Master P on this track? He wasn’t that bad, but man, they could’ve put Keith Murray or someone hella dope instead…either way it goes, this is dope. Too bad the album it was on was trash.

Watch for The Hook (Outkast, Goodie Mob, Cool Breeze)
“Tryna kill 4 birds, with about 15 stones”
-Cool Breeze
I had to put this one up for Meka. I think (I don’t really remember, weed kills brain cells) he said this was one of the shit songs he liked. I don’t really think it’s shit, I mean, I can’t understand Khujo, but I understand MOST of the song, and most of them brought it. They should have let Andre 3000 get a longer verse. This cat Cool Breeze brought some real talk on this song, but I never heard of him ever again. The track is dope, too bad the dungeon family couldn’t bring it like this on their album.
